Foreign prisoners outnumber local inmates in some South African prisons

View descriptionShare
 

Foreign prisoners now outnumber local inmates in some correctional services facilities, putting a strain on South Africa's prisons. Parliament's Correctional Services Committee Chairperson Anthea Ramolobeng, who revealed the statistics yesterday says over 22,500 foreigners are currently incarcerated in correctional centers. She says the surge in foreign prisoners has significant implications for the country's correctional system, which is already grappling with issues like overcrowding and resource constraints.
